Output 0c6cf765c33ba681166525cb2b4644e8dd62b129bd795731b688eb7b9a5a60ed:1

value
3043666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376143287f1e9cdac71dc74b5ee97742327a7 OP_EQUAL
address
3BMEXfoeUhNqNMHmE6YbUT8TGs3hTmYQTx
transaction
0c6cf765c33ba681166525cb2b4644e8dd62b129bd795731b688eb7b9a5a60ed
spent
true